Nonprofit Technology News for May 2014

Tech Soup

It’s time to catch up on some nonprofit technology trends and news again! Europe’s highest court in a ruling against Google has decided that search engines should allow online users to be “forgotten” after a certain time by erasing links to web pages unless there are particular reasons not to erase that information.

How Nonprofits Can Build Trust with Strong Internal Controls

sgEngage

In 2013, CBS News reported that the U.S. Justice Department froze federal grant funding to a nonprofit after an audit revealed that they couldn’t account for nearly $20 million dollars of federal funds that were drawn by the organization for mentoring youth.
